Discover more about Lučki most

Lučki most, also known as the Stari Most or Old Bridge, is a breathtaking architectural masterpiece that stands proudly over the Neretva River in the heart of Mostar. This iconic bridge, built in the 16th century, is not only a significant historical monument but also a UNESCO World Heritage site. With its elegant arches and stunning stonework, Lučki most has become a symbol of the city's resilience, surviving the destruction during the Bosnian War and being meticulously rebuilt in 2004. As you approach the bridge, you'll be captivated by the picturesque views of the turquoise waters below and the surrounding ancient Ottoman architecture. Walking across the bridge offers a unique perspective of the vibrant old town, where traditional shops, cafes, and bazaars come to life. Be sure to take a moment to enjoy the panoramic vistas from the middle of the bridge, where you can see both sides of the river and the colorful rooftops of Mostar. Adventurous visitors can also experience the thrill of watching local divers leap from the bridge into the river, a tradition that has been celebrated for centuries. The atmosphere around Lučki most is lively and welcoming, making it an ideal spot for a leisurely stroll, photography, or simply soaking in the beauty of this remarkable location.
